Job Responsibilities

  • Achieve business and organization goals, visions and objectives.
  • Manage the delivery of nursing care and practice of professional nursing for non-hospitalized patients within a specified department, procedural area, and/or infusion area.
  • Collaborate with liaison departments in maintaining patient care standards utilizing evidence-based practice as applicable.
  • Participate in clinical nursing research and support The University of Kansas Health System research activities.
  • Assist with front and back office as needed to identify and resolve issues affecting patient flow and the delivery of care.
  • Manage operation of assigned areas by analyzing personnel structure, determining staffing needs, monitoring productivity, and providing direction that reflects patient and family needs across the continuum of care.
  • Provide supervision, evaluate performance, and conduct selection and termination processes.
  • Ensure clinical team works at top of licensure/responsibility.
  • Actively promote staff and self-development.
  • Develop and maintain department related patient care standards through continuous quality improvement.
  • Develop quality and safety initiatives to provide the highest level of care.
  • Oversee development and implementation of policies and procedures to ensure efficient, effective, evidence-based delivery of health services.
  • Assess the environment and make recommendations to ensure optimal patient comfort, safety and compliance with various regulatory bodies (OSHA, JCAHO, etc.).
  • Foster patient and employee satisfaction.
  • Promote shared decision-making with input from staff.
  • Assist in the development and monitoring of the budget.
  • Approve purchases, establish and revise inventory quotes.
  • Collaborate with nursing colleagues in ambulatory care to promote optimal utilization of nursing resources.
